Output 23b4810b43ee24af87c2826af7d165b9b2c1bc74da8113bd55e89495244fde19:40

value
3055756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e54659ca30396684f8214e2fb648a609e86ff40 OP_EQUAL
address
3QsnfGb7Wp8pCQFpFJE7zinQ2tM8WNEziG
transaction
23b4810b43ee24af87c2826af7d165b9b2c1bc74da8113bd55e89495244fde19
spent
true